开发者社区> 问答> 正文

小程序页面结构是什么?

小程序页面结构是什么?

展开
收起
社区秘书 2020-04-27 13:55:21 1075 0
1 条回答
写回答
取消 提交回答
  • 概述 Page 代表应用的一个页面,负责页面展示和交互。每个页面对应一个子目录,一 般有多少个页面,就有多少个子目录。它也是一个构造函数,用来生成页面实例。 每个小程序页面一般包含四个文件。  [pageName].js:页面逻辑  [pageName].axml:页面结构  [pageName].acss:页面样式(可选)  [pageName].json:页面配置(可选) 页面初始化时,提供数据。

     data: {
     title: 'Alipay',
     array: [{user: 'li'}, {user: 'zhao'}],
     },
    });
    

    根据以上提供的数据,渲染页面内容。 {{title}} {{array[0].user}} 定义交互行为时,需要指定响应函数。 click me 以上代码指定用户触摸按钮时,调用 handleTap 方法。

     handleTap() {
     console.log('yo! view tap!');
     },
    });
    

    页面重新渲染,需要在页面脚本里面调用 this.setData 方法。 {{text}} 以上代码指定用户触摸按钮时,调用 changeText 方法。

     data: {
     text: 'init data',
     },
     changeText() {
     this.setData({
     text: 'changed data',
     });
     },
    });
    

    上面代码中,changeText 方法里面调用 this.setData 方法,会导致页面重新渲 染。

    内容来源:https://developer.aliyun.com/article/756818?spm=a2c6h.12873581.0.dArticle756818.26162b70Su1GZy&groupCode=tech_library

    2020-04-27 13:56:24
    赞同 展开评论 打赏
问答分类:
问答标签:
问答地址:
问答排行榜
最热
最新

相关电子书

更多
《云市场-小程序》 立即下载
数字乡村建设方案 立即下载
mPaaS 小程序新品发布 立即下载